Koh Samui has been named the best island in the Asia-Pacific region at the Travel + Leisure Luxury Awards 2026, with the island’s airport and five of its resorts also collecting top-10 finishes across separate categories at the same event.

The recognition was announced by the Deputy Government Spokesperson, Ploythalay Laksamisaengchan, who said the government welcomed the result as a reflection of Koh Samui’s capacity to receive international visitors at a luxury standard while maintaining its natural environment.

Beyond the Best Islands title, Samui International Airport placed second in the Best Airports category for the region, ranked behind Singapore’s Changi Airport.

The airport was recognised by Travel + Leisure for its design, which the organisation noted for its integration with the surrounding natural environment, and for the quality of its passenger services.

Five resorts on the island placed in the top 10 of the Best Beach and Island Resorts in Thailand category. Cape Fahn Hotel took second place, Four Seasons Resort Koh Samui placed fifth, Kimpton Kitalay Samui came in seventh, Anantara Lawana Koh Samui Resort placed eighth, and Centara Reserve Samui ranked ninth.

Ploythalay said the government intends to use the recognition as a basis for further development, with policy focused on distributing tourism income to local communities alongside sustainability, safety improvements, and better connectivity.

The deputy spokesperson also revealed that infrastructure projects are being planned to improve air access to islands on the Andaman Sea coast, and that island tourism would be developed as a model for eco-tourism to preserve natural resources for future generations.

At the same time, tourism operators on Koh Samui and Koh Phangan have backed a government crackdown on “mafia” influence networks they say are damaging the islands’ reputations through extortion, price gouging, and nominee business structures concealing foreign ownership.

State agencies have already begun inspections on both islands, targeting these networks.
